Walton is on his way to the north poleship gets trapped between impassable iceWalton and his crew are waiting for the ice to meltrescue Frankenstein who chases monsterFrankenstein recovers and tells Walton his storycrew wants to turn around and head home but Victor convinces them to wait, appells on their braveness and couragein the end, returning home anywaysvictor dies

European, speaking English with a foreign accentat the brink of destructionstate of suffering and griefeyes: expression of wildness / madnessalthough kind, benevolent, sweet, wise, cultivated, eloquentgnashing his teeth -> impatiencethankful to Walton and his crewafter hearing about the creature: new spirits, thirst for action, eager to continue his chasestill weak, silent, uneasyhis manners: conciliating, gentle, attentivehis looks: attractive, amiabledouble existence: suffers misery, grief vs. being a celestial spirit to otherswhat makes him special? ->intuitive discernment, power of judgement, facility of self expression

Walton and the monster experiencing similar feelings of lonelinessdesire companions who they can share their life with, who they can talk toboth have high standards have gone through loneliness and self-education > lead to selfishness (Walton putting his crew in danger) and revenge (Monster killing people)

Walton and Victor as mad mencompletely consumed with one task (finding passage way, creating life) > turns each man into danger to themselves plus those around them-desire fame and acknowledgement that comes with their discoveries > think, they deserve itJesus complex -> see themselves being the greatest gift to the human racethey are both aware that their ambitions have caused pain to others

contrast Walton and Victor -> highlighting Victors story > Walton and Monster both want a friend > Walton finds a friend in Victor vs. Monster gets rejectedcreates emotional distance to Victorenables the reader to reflect upon the causes of his brokenness and on his failed behaviourIn general: many similarities between characters, looking from different perspectives
